Wow! I just stumbled upon this program and it looks great. :) I have a few questions on its features I hope you won't mind answering. I design my own pen and paper RPGs and would love to convert some of them into Augur so I could play solo against my RPG. This would be a great way to test the system mechanics of my RPG designs without having to put friends through a testing phase. :)

1. Is it possible to create an entire custom ruleset that includes custom monsters, experience leveling, equipment, spells, and loot tables as well?

2. I read that the older version had loot tables that would automatically place loot in dungeons and such. Has that functionality been added to the current version?

3. Is it possible to somehow limit the number of spaces or hexes a character or monster can move based on a stat such as "SPEED"? So, for example I move my avatar 5 spaces which is my maximum movement rate per turn. Is there a way within the program to stop the character from moving farther than allowed during the current game turn or combat round?

4. Is there a way to export the maps, story content, etc. so that it can be used when playing with friends around the table or online via a multiplayer capable VTT program?

5. Is it possible to have a method for character creation within the app itself or do I have to design my custom character sheet and then perform the steps to create a new character outside the program and then insert the results into the Augur character sheet that I create? It would be neat if we could setup a step by step process for rolling stats, picking skills, and then equipping out character before setting out on an adventure.

6. Are shops and places such as taverns, temples, etc. auto generated within towns? So for example if I enter a town will a random weapon shop possibly be there with a list of goods for sale and their costs?

7. Can items such as weapons and armor be given stats that can automatically be added to a combat roll? For example: A sword adds +1 to a 2d6 attack roll. So if the sword is equipped, when making an attack roll the system would automatically roll 2d6 and add the +1 from the equipped sword? Also, for armor if a suit of armor deducts a value from an attacker's attack roll, can that be automatically added as well to the attack roll? Ex: Attacker with sword vs. Target with plate armor -5. An attack button is pressed and automatically rolls 2d6+1(from sword) -5(from target's armor) then gives the total score and a hit or miss result? This would be an awesome feature if it is not already possible.
